Plugins loaded via PYTEST_PLUGINS or pytest_plugins are not reported · Issue #12615 · pytest-dev/pytest (original) (raw)

When I load a plugin using the PYTEST_ADDOPTS environment variable then the plugin is properly reported in the list of plugins:

$ env - PYTEST_DISABLE_PLUGIN_AUTOLOAD=1 PYTEST_ADDOPTS='-p randomly' pytest --setup-plan
============================= test session starts ==============================
platform sunos5 -- Python 3.9.19, pytest-8.2.2, pluggy-1.5.0
Using --randomly-seed=2747766829
rootdir: /tmp/test
plugins: randomly-3.15.0
collected 0 items                                                              

============================ no tests ran in 0.03s =============================
$

When I try to achieve the same using the PYTEST_PLUGINS environment variable then the plugin is not listed in the list of plugins:

$ env - PYTEST_DISABLE_PLUGIN_AUTOLOAD=1 PYTEST_PLUGINS=pytest_randomly pytest --setup-plan
============================= test session starts ==============================
platform sunos5 -- Python 3.9.19, pytest-8.2.2, pluggy-1.5.0
Using --randomly-seed=3835907952
rootdir: /tmp/test
collected 0 items                                                              

============================ no tests ran in 0.03s =============================
$

but the plugin is apparently properly loaded (please note --randomly-seed).

It would be great to see plugins loaded via the PYTEST_PLUGINS environment variable reported too to avoid confusion.

EDIT: the same problem is seen when the pytest_plugins global variable is used to load plugins.
